`
l4432848
  • 浏览: 254303 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

mysql操作指令

    博客分类:
  • java
阅读更多

一、连接mysql 进入 mysql 的安装目录; $ bin/mysql -p [host IP 如果是登录本地的mysql 可以不写 -p 直接 -u] -u [userName] -p 输入密码,回车,接连;

  二、权限操作[如果你很了解mysql数据库后,你可以直接去修改系统表,然后用 mysql> flush privileges; 指令让权限生效]

  1、赋权 mysql>GRANT ALL[权限名,all 表示所有权限] PRIVILEGES ON [dataBaseName *.* 表示所有库] TO [userName]@[ip,%表未任意ip] IDENTIFIED BY [password, 可以为空] WITH GRANT OPTION;

  2、收回权限 mysql> revoke all[权限名,all 表示所有权限] on [dataBaseName *.* 表示所有库] from [userName]@[ip, 任意ip 时请用 %] ;

  注:MYSQL权限详细分类:

  全局管理权限:

  FILE: 在MySQL服务器上读写文件。

  PROCESS: 显示或杀死属于其它用户的服务线程。

  RELOAD: 重载访问控制表,刷新日志等。

  SHUTDOWN: 关闭MySQL服务。

  数据库/数据表/数据列权限:

  ALTER: 修改已存在的数据表(例如增加/删除列)和索引。

  CREATE: 建立新的数据库或数据表。

  DELETE: 删除表的记录。

  DROP: 删除数据表或数据库。

  INDEX: 建立或删除索引。

  INSERT: 增加表的记录。

  SELECT: 显示/搜索表的记录。

  UPDATE: 修改表中已存在的记录。

  特别的权限:

  ALL: 允许做任何事(和root一样)。

  USAGE: 只允许登录--其它什么也不允许做。

  三、用户级操作

  1、新建用户

  2、修改密码

  四、数据库级操作

  1、新建库

  2、显示数据库 mysql>show databases;

  3、查看数据库 mysql>use [databaseName]

  4、查看当前连接的数据库

  五、表操作

  1、新建表

  2、删除表

  3、修改改表名

  4、新增主键

  5、修改主键

  6、删除主键

  7、新增外键

  8、修改外键

  9、删除外键

  10、添加唯一键

  11、新增字段

  12、修改字段

  13、删除字段

  六、数据操作

  1、查询设置格式

  2、insert into select

  七、备份

  1、导出整个数据库、导入速个库

  2、导出某个表、导入某个表

  3、导出数据库的结构、导入数据库结构

  其他操作:

  1、显示MYSQL的版本 mysql> select version();

  2、显示当前时间 mysql> select now();

技术分享:www.kaige123.com

0
0
分享到:
评论

相关推荐

    MySQL操作命令语句

    以下是一些关键的MySQL操作命令及其详细说明: 1. **连接MySQL**: - **本地连接**:在DOS窗口中,进入MySQL的bin目录,输入`mysql -u root -p`,然后按回车输入密码。如果root用户没有设置密码,直接回车即可。 ...

    MySQL操作命令以及JDBC连接Mysql编程的步骤

    一、MySQL操作命令 1. **启动与退出** - 启动MySQL服务,可以通过命令行工具MySQL Command Line Client或者通过系统服务管理命令。 - 退出MySQL,输入`quit`或`exit`。 2. **数据库操作** - 创建数据库:`...

    Mysql操作命令.pdf

    Mysql操作命令.pdf 学习Mysql操作命令能让我们提高工作效率

    mysql操作命令

    以下是对给定文件中提到的MySQL操作命令的详细解析,旨在帮助读者深入理解并掌握这些常用指令。 #### 1. 显示当前系统中的所有数据库 命令:`SHOW DATABASES;` 该命令用于列出MySQL服务器上存在的所有数据库。这...

    linux下mysql 操作命令.docx

    Linux 下 MySQL 操作命令 MySQL 是一个流行的开源关系数据库管理系统,广泛应用于各种 Web 应用程序中。在 Linux 环境下,MySQL 的操作命令是开发者和数据库管理员必须掌握的基本技能。本文总结了 Linux 下 MySQL ...

    linux下mysql操作命令.doc

    linux下mysql操作命令.doc

    MySQL最实用的操作命令

    - **命令**:指用于与MySQL交互的具体指令。 - **DOS**:虽然这里的上下文可能不明确,但可以理解为在Windows操作系统下的命令行环境中运行MySQL命令。 - **常用**:指经常被使用的MySQL命令。 - **最全**:意味着...

    mysql常用操作命令

    mysql常用操作命令 mysql是一个流行的关系数据库管理系统,作为开发人员,掌握mysql的常用操作命令是非常必要的。本文将对mysql的常用操作命令进行总结,包括连接mysql、查询版本信息、查询当前日期、查询服务器中...

    mysql的常用操作指令

    ### MySQL的常用操作指令知识点详解 #### 一、MySQL简介及基本概念 - **数据库(Database)**:存储数据的仓库。 - **数据库管理系统(DBMS)**:用于创建和管理数据库的应用软件,如MySQL、Oracle等。 - **关系型...

    MySQL常用操作命令

    MySQL常用操作命令 MySQL是一种关系数据库管理系统,常用于各种应用程序的数据存储和管理。...掌握这些基本的MySQL操作命令对于使用MySQL数据库非常重要,可以帮助您更好地管理和维护您的数据库。

    MYSQL常用操作命令整理.pdf

    DOS窗口,然后进入目录mysql\bin,再键入命令mysql -u root -p,回车后提示你输密码.注意 . MYSQL,超级用户root是没有密码的,故直接回车即可进入到MYSQL中了,MYSQL的提示符 mysql> 、

    Linux操作MySql的基本命令

    Linux 操作 MySQL 的基本命令 Linux 操作 MySQL 的基本命令是 MySQL 数据库管理的基础,了解这些命令可以帮助用户更好地管理和维护 MySQL 数据库。 1. 创建 mysqld 数据库的管理用户 在 Linux 下创建 mysqld ...

    MYSQL操作常用命令

    ### MySQL操作常用命令及密码重置详解 #### 忘记MySQL ROOT密码的处理方法 当您忘记了MySQL数据库的ROOT密码时,可以通过以下步骤进行重置: 1. **编辑MySQL配置文件** - **Windows环境**: 编辑路径为 `%MySQL_...

    redhat 下mysql的安装和操作命令

    以下将详细解析在Red Hat系统上安装MySQL及其相关Perl模块的过程,并提供一些基本的MySQL操作命令。 ### 一、安装Perl模块 在安装MySQL之前,确保系统已安装Perl的DBI和DBD::MySQL模块,因为它们是与MySQL交互所...

    MySQL数据库操作指令.pdf

    需要注意的是,文档提到的这些操作命令在Mac环境下同样适用,因为它们都是标准的MySQL操作指令。通过这些操作,我们能够对MySQL数据库进行基础的维护和数据管理。这份文档适合初学者作为学习MySQL的入门材料。

    MySQL数据库命令大全

    ### MySQL数据库命令详解 #### 一、MySQL服务的管理 MySQL作为一款广泛使用的开源关系型数据库...以上是MySQL数据库中常见的命令操作,熟练掌握这些命令能够帮助数据库管理员或开发者更高效地管理和使用MySQL数据库。

    MYSQL命令大全

    ### MySQL命令大全:掌握数据库操作的核心技能 #### 引言 在IT领域,尤其是在数据库管理与开发中,熟练掌握MySQL数据库的命令是至关重要的。本文将深入解析从启动与退出MySQL,到数据库与表的各种操作命令,帮助...

Global site tag (gtag.js) - Google Analytics